[BACK]Return to macrotag.in CVS log [TXT][DIR] Up to [cvsweb.bsd.lv] / mandoc / regress / man / TP

File: [cvsweb.bsd.lv] / mandoc / regress / man / TP / macrotag.in (download)

Revision 1.3, Wed Sep 9 17:01:11 2020 UTC (3 years, 8 months ago) by schwarze
Branch: MAIN
CVS Tags: VERSION_1_14_6, HEAD
Changes since 1.2: +15 -3 lines

Element next-line scopes can nest.  Consequently, even when closing
one element next-line scope, the MAN_ELINE flag must not yet be
cleared if the parent macro is another element macro having next-line
scope, or an assertion failure is caused if all this is wrapped in
another macro that has block next-line scope, for example .TP.
Bug found in an afl run performed by Jan Schreiber <jes at posteo dot de>.

.\" $OpenBSD: macrotag.in,v 1.4 2020/09/09 16:57:05 schwarze Exp $
.TH TP-MACROTAG 1 "September 9, 2020"
.SH NAME
TP-macrotag \- macros in the head of tagged paragraphs
.SH DESCRIPTION
regular
text
.TP
.B longindent
indented
text
.TP
.B
.I
next-line
indented
text
.TP
.B
.SM
bold small
indented
text
.PP
regular
text